Math · 7–8
Houghton Mifflin Harcourt (Saxon Publishers)
Top pickSaxon Math 8/7 uses incremental development where new concepts are introduced in small pieces and continuously reviewed through daily mixed practice sets. Each lesson includes warm-up activities (facts practice, mental math, problem-solving), new concept introduction, lesson practice, and 25-30 mixed practice problems combining new and previously taught material. Reviews arithmetic while introducing pre-algebra concepts preparing students for Algebra 1.

Math · 8–10
Art of Problem Solving
Top pickArt of Problem Solving's Introduction to Geometry uses a rigorous, proof-based approach that prioritizes understanding over memorization. The curriculum develops critical thinking and mathematical maturity through scaffolded problem sets that range from straightforward applications to olympiad-style challenges. Students learn to construct valid arguments and see geometry as a logical system rather than a collection of formulas.

Math · 8–10
Houghton Mifflin Harcourt
Top pickSaxon Algebra 1 (3rd Edition) uses incremental development where concepts are introduced in small pieces, practiced immediately, then continuously reviewed in mixed problem sets. This classic edition integrates geometry with algebra throughout the course. Each lesson includes new concept introduction, worked examples, practice problems, and a mixed problem set reviewing all previously learned material.

Math-U-See uses manipulatives and visual models to build conceptual understanding before symbolic work, emphasizing mastery of each topic before progression. Lessons follow a consistent structure: introduction, demonstration via video, student practice, and daily cumulative review. The approach targets students who benefit from concrete, hands-on learning.

Math-U-See uses concrete manipulatives (base-ten blocks) to visualize abstract concepts, progressing from hands-on models to semi-concrete representations to abstract notation. Lessons emphasize mastery of one concept before advancing, with built-in spiral review. Parent-led instruction with video support reduces prep while maintaining interactivity.
